In retrieveAppEntry of NotificationAccessDetails.java, there is a missing permission check vulnerability (CVE-2023-21107) affecting Android versions 11, 12, 12L, and 13. The vulnerability was disclosed in the May 2023 Android Security Bulletin (Android Bulletin).
The vulnerability stems from a missing permission check in the NotificationAccessDetails.java component, specifically in the retrieveAppEntry function. It has been assigned a CVSS v3.1 base score of 7.8 (HIGH) with the vector string C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H. The vulnerability is classified as CWE-276 (Incorrect Default Permissions) (NVD).
A successful exploitation of this vulnerability could lead to local escalation of privilege across user boundaries. The high CVSS score indicates potential severe impacts on conf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the affected system (NVD).
The vulnerability was addressed in the Android Security Bulletin for May 2023. Users should update their Android devices to the latest security patch level to mitigate this vulnerability (Android Bulletin).
